Encapsulation To Extend The Life of Your HVAC

At Coastal Home Services, we understand how harsh the coastal environment here in eastern North Carolina can be on your home’s systems including your HVAC
unit. We’re excited to now offer Rust Grip encapsulation that is proven to extend the lifespan of your HVAC by protecting it from weather and the environment.
Rust Grip is a liquid coating that is designed to seal air, moisture and chemicals out of surfaces completely. Rust Grip will seal virtually any surface
to protect it against physical wear, corrosion and weather. In just one application, the liquid serves as a primer, intermediate and top coat.


Here are some benefits to using Rust Grip:

  • Minimum preparation required
  • UV protective and durable
  • It works fast – the cure cycle begins within an hour of application so the liquid penetrates and swells to seal the surface pores
  • Easy to use
  • Will withstand salts, acids and caustics
  • Rated as a Class A fire coating
  • Strengthens surfaces and increases lifespan

Rust Grip can extend the life of your HVAC system for up to 7 years! Although Rust Grip requires minimal preparation, we recommend application on units
